INTERNAL MEMO
To: Sales Leads
From: Marnie Voss, Commercial Operations
Re: Marketing Budget Adjustment

Effective next quarter, the marketing budget for the Kestrelline product family will be reduced by 18%. Paid campaigns in the Averton and Dunmore regions will pause first; trade-show commitments already signed remain funded. Lead volume targets will be revised by end of month, and quota adjustments will follow where justified. Direct questions to your regional planner. A confidential note on related business plans follows below.

management briefing: The renewal with Quenaelox Group closes at $2 million a year, 15 percent below the last contract. Project Holwyn slips by six weeks because of the tooling delay.

Ticket — Facilities Desk, Pellan House. Hi team, contractor from Brightloom Joinery starts Monday for a one-week fit-out on level 3. Can we sort access before 08:00 Monday so he's not stuck in the lobby again like last time? He'll need the loading bay, level 3 east corridor, and the tool store. Escort not required after day one per Siobhan's sign-off. I've cleared it with security already; they just need the details logged. Temporary badge code for the week is below.

staff pass of kawip-hawef = bdg-QLP-2

**14:22 — Export retries kick in (FerryLedger postmortem)**

Heads up for newer folks: this is where things got interesting. The retry worker picked up the 412 failed exports and started hammering the downstream queue with no backoff — a known gap we'd been meaning to fix. Dasha paused the worker at 14:29 and re-ran with jitter enabled. The worker build that misbehaved is identified by the token below.

pipeline stamp: htk31_f769b577b3028a4e9958e5bb8d1259a

**Ticket PLX-4417: Circuit breaker for Quillfeed upstream API**

Plugin authors: calls to the Quillfeed pricing endpoint now pass through a circuit breaker in the Lantergate SDK. After five consecutive failures, the breaker opens for 30 seconds and your plugin receives a BreakerOpen error instead of a timeout. Handle it gracefully rather than retrying in a loop. The breaker state was verified against the following build.

build token for kagaf-hahof: htk14_9d3d4d26d7d8de